One of the forums here for compatible software packages that uses Galil is Camsoft.
You did not indicate what type of gantry you are designing i.e. router, Plasma or....? and the degree of accuracy.
When you indicated a travel of 16 feet I did not think you would be going with a screw. The vast majority of commercial router & plasma tables I have come across use rack and pinion, if meshing is done correctly they can be very accurate, also precision rack is available.
Also for a gantry weight of 250lbs the inertia will be such that if you require a high feed rate with rapid acceleration you will probabally be in need of some kind of reduction between motor and drive.
